Tillers & Cultivators Market Key Growth Drivers and Demand Factors
The tillers & cultivators market was valued at USD 10.5 billion in 2024 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 6.2%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2033, reaching an estimated USD 18.8 billion by 2033.
The tillers and cultivators market is experiencing sustainable expansion driven by converging agricultural, economic, and technological factors reshaping farming operations globally. Agricultural mechanization across Asia-Pacific, Latin America, and Africa is accelerating as smallholder farmers recognize that manual soil preparation methods prove economically inefficient compared to mechanized equipment delivering superior results in fraction of traditional timeframes. Rising labor costs in developed agricultural regions are forcing farmers toward equipment-intensive operations that reduce reliance on seasonal workers while maintaining consistent soil preparation quality.
Climate change impacts and soil degradation concerns are driving farmer investment in precision cultivation equipment enabling targeted soil treatment, reduced compaction, and improved water retention capabilities. Government support programs providing agricultural mechanization subsidies and financing options are facilitating farmer access to tiller and cultivator equipment previously considered economically inaccessible. The expansion of large-scale commercial farming operations, contract farming arrangements, and agricultural service centers has created substantial demand centers for professional-grade cultivation equipment. Technological innovations introducing GPS-guided systems, variable rate application capabilities, and automated depth control are attracting investment from technology-forward farmers seeking competitive advantages through operational precision.
Organic farming growth and regenerative agriculture adoption are driving demand for specialized cultivation equipment enabling reduced chemical inputs while maintaining productivity. Rural electrification initiatives and improved farm infrastructure across emerging markets are expanding the feasible customer base for electric and hybrid-powered tiller and cultivator solutions. Increasing awareness regarding soil health, carbon sequestration, and sustainable farming practices is accelerating adoption of equipment designed to minimize soil disturbance while optimizing nutrient distribution. Post-harvest machinery integration and equipment financing accessibility improvements are simplifying farmer adoption of mechanized cultivation solutions across diverse economic and operational contexts.

Tillers & Cultivators Market Challenges, Risks and Market Barriers
The tillers and cultivators market confronts significant challenges including high initial equipment costs deterring smallholder farmers in developing regions from mechanization adoption. Inadequate farm infrastructure including poor road conditions, limited electricity access, and insufficient equipment servicing networks creates operational barriers across many emerging agricultural regions. Equipment maintenance and repair service availability remains inconsistent across rural areas, creating reliability concerns for farmers dependent on timely cultivation completion. Competing farmer financing opportunities and alternative equipment investments constrain capital allocation toward tiller and cultivator purchases. Technical knowledge gaps regarding equipment operation, maintenance, and optimal utilization practices limit farmer adoption and equipment effectiveness. Market fragmentation across diverse geographic regions with varying farmer needs, economic capacities, and operational conditions complicates standardized equipment development and marketing strategies.

Tillers & Cultivators Market Regional Performance and Geographic Expansion
North American and European agricultural markets demonstrate mature mechanization with equipment modernization and sustainability-focused upgrades driving replacement demand. Asia-Pacific regions exhibit exceptional growth trajectories powered by rapid agricultural mechanization among smallholder farmers, government support programs, and rising farm incomes enabling equipment investment. India and Southeast Asian nations demonstrate particularly strong demand growth as agricultural productivity pressures and labor constraints accelerate equipment adoption. African agricultural markets show emerging growth potential as rural electrification, equipment financing accessibility, and farming commercialization advance farmer mechanization capacity. Latin American markets demonstrate consistent expansion driven by large-scale commercial farming operations and expanding smallholder farmer mechanization participation.
